weary in Latin

weary in Latin

dēfessus
adj
Having the strength exhausted by toil or exertion; tired; fatigued.
fessus
adj
Having the strength exhausted by toil or exertion; tired; fatigued.
lassus
adj
Having the strength exhausted by toil or exertion; tired; fatigued.
fatīgō
verb
(ambitransitive) To make or to become weary.
